Danny Wang, Ph.D has a strong background in credit risk modeling and analytics, with progressive roles in various companies such as Republic Bank and Caliber Financial Services. Danny has played a significant role in building and expanding credit risk modeling teams and developing credit policies and strategies for various bank products. Additionally, Danny has experience in business strategy and risk development, as well as quantitative modeling. Prior to their current roles, Danny worked as an analyst at Blue Cross Blue Shield of Michigan. Danny holds a Doctor of Philosophy in Industrial Engineering from the University of Louisville.

Republic Bancorp, Inc. (Republic) is a financial holding company of Republic Bank & Trust Company (the Bank) and Republic Insurance Services, Inc. (the Captive). The Bank is a Kentucky-based, state chartered non-member financial institution. The Captive is an insurance subsidiary of the Company. It operates in four segments: Traditional Banking, which provides traditional banking products primarily to customers; Warehouse Lending (Warehouse), which provides short-term, revolving credit facilities to mortgage bankers across the Nation; Mortgage Banking, which originates, sells and services long-term, single family, first lien residential real estate loans, and Republic Processing Group (RPG), which facilitates the receipt and payment of federal and state tax refund products. . In addition to Internet Banking and Correspondent Lending delivery channels, the Company has approximately 44 full-service banking centers.
